Transaction

d954967a80c1237aa2ac60ed2f43fcffadf937cf5aa36a82c6531e15204fc786
362,647 confirmations
Timestamp
1557164708
Block574,873
Fee10,299 sats
Fee rate62 sats/vB
view on mempool.space

Inputs & Outputs